Justice A.T Mohammed of the Federal High Court, Port Harcourt, on Friday sentenced one Tarila Ebizimor to seven years imprisonment for obtaining money under false pretence to the tune of N4,000,000.00.
The convict, a supervisor in the Security Department of the Niger Delta Development Commission, NDDC was prosecuted by the Port Harcourt Zonal Office of the EFCC on a four-count charge.
Details of the court ruling on Ebizimor’s fraud case was posted on the official Twitter account of the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ission, @officialsefcc.
Ebizimor’s journey to prison began in August, 2013 when he paraded himself as personal assistant to managing director of the NDDC and obtained the sum of N4million from the petitioner on the pretext that he will help facilitate the award of road construction contract to him.
